The Da Nang government has directed relevant local agencies to soon implement a plan to pilot night tourism and services on Nguyen Van Troi Bridge in the first quarter of 2024. Accordingly, Nguyen Van Troi Bridge and a park at the eastern end of the bridge will become a night tourist site with many unique fun activities.

The Da Nang administration has issued an official dispatch agreeing on a pilot plan to organize services for night tourism on Nguyen Van Troi Bridge and a park at the foot of Nguyen Van Troi Bridge as proposed by the municipal Department of Tourism.

Under the plan, in Phase 1 (2024), a number of activities will be held in this area such as install lighting decorations to create check-in points, an exhibition of pictures and displays of specialized products/works periodically every quarter and on holidays and Tet; organise stage performances of ethnic music and lyrical music, street dance shows on Tran Hung Dao and Chuong Duong streets, flash mob events, yoga festivals, street art on Nguyen Van Troi Bridge, book and beer festivals in the park area.

At the same time, the city will organize community activities such as sports, fitness training, jogging, chess and painting competitions, walking tours, sightseeing and community activities, street music, events and festivals on Nguyen Van Troi Bridge; children's games; fast food services, take-away beverages and souvenirs.

In Phase 2, from the first quarter of 2025 to the end of 2028, the  city will continue to implement Phase 1 activities and renovate, upgrade and exploit tourism activities on Nguyen Van Troi Bridge and park on the eastern end of the bridge.

Accordingly, relevant agencies will organize street art performances such as portrait painting, magic, bubble shaping, aerobics, street music, business booths selling souvenirs, OCOP products, mobile carts/counters serving refreshments and fast food. Besides, there are special events and festivals periodically on weekends, holidays, and Tet at the northern and southern yards of the park on the eastern end of Nguyen Van Troi Bridge.

The municipal government has assigned the Son Tra District administration to preside over and coordinate with relevant agencies to organise the implementation of the plan in accordance with regulations, develop detailed plans and roadmaps to ensure implementation on schedule and according to custom procedures. 

The municipal Department of Tourism will coordinate with the Son Tra District authorities to implement the plan and make reports to the Chairman of the municipal People's Committee on contents that need to be adjusted and supplemented in accordance with the actual situation.

The municipal Department of Culture and Sports is responsible for supporting and coordinating with reputable event organisers and specialized associations to organize cultural and artistic events to serve people and tourists.

Nguyen Van Troi Bridge is the first bridge across the Han River, put into use since 1965. By 2015, the control system and lifting span of the Nguyen Van Troi Bridge were renovated, installed and transferred the technology of control and monitoring system for lifting spans to serve navigation.

Nguyen Van Troi Bridge currently no longer has the function of operating traffic, instead it is a unique tourist bridge of Da Nang.
